Heat Levels: From Sweet to Spicy
Among the most distinguishing characteristics of romance fiction is the range of heat levels readily available, dealing with every reader's convenience zone and preference. At the sweeter end, clean romance and wholesome love keep physical intimacy off the page, focusing rather on emotional connection, wholehearted gestures, and often a faith-centered or family-oriented point of view. Closed-door romance might include sexual tension however fades to black before explicit details.
On the other side of the spectrum, steamy romance and spicy romance look into high-heat encounters, often checking out the physical side of destination in detail. High heat romance pushes the boundaries further, incorporating sensuality as a core part of character advancement and plot. Psychological Beats and Reader Satisfaction
While the specifics vary, most love books are developed around specific psychological beats that readers anticipate. There's the meet-cute or preliminary spark, where chemistry ignites. Tension develops Show details through minutes of attraction, misconception, and vulnerability, culminating in a central pivotal moment where characters should make pivotal options.
Romance readers likewise expect a gratifying resolution, frequently described as a "HEA" (Happily Ever After) or "HFN" (Happy For Now). In tidy romance, this might suggest a proposition, marital relationship, or heartfelt commitment, while in steamy romance, it may include a more enthusiastic declaration. The assurance of an emotionally satisfying ending is among the genre's biggest conveniences-- it permits readers to enjoy the highs and lows of a story, knowing love will eventually dominate.
